Personally I am against point penalties at ANY stage and for ANY reason - this type of penalty basically sayd you were good enough to race, but not good enough to get championship points.

Apply penalties against RACE RESULTS - and preferably on the day. IMHO unless it is a major incident, penalties applied on the day/weekend cop a race result adjustment.

Anything decided afterwards, except a major incident, gets a fine only. The only other adjustment that should be allowed afterwards is exclusion - totally - none of this slap on the wrist stuff.

And, as I said - this should apply across every category in racing.

Finally - match the penalty to the crime - speeding in pit lane - exclusion of the lap prior to coming in (practice and qualifying - like trucks do now for speeding on track).

And none of this stop/go penalty BS
